Titan and Hyperion orbit Saturn with periods of 15.94542 and 21.27661 Earth days, respectively. Their period ratio is very close to 4/3, with Titan making very close to 4 orbits for every 3 orbits that Hyperion makes. Because of this orbit resonance, Titan gives Hyperion a forced eccentricity of 0.123. Notice how Hyperion is farthest from Saturn at conjunction with Titan; such avoidance is typical of resonances. In the video, I made the resonance exact, gave Titan a circular orbit, and drew Saturn and its rings to scale, but not Titan or Hyperion. TtnT, HypT, and SynT are times in Titan orbits, Hyperion orbits, and synodic periods.
